The document is a Termination of Listing Agreement designed for real estate transactions in Pennsylvania. It outlines the mutual agreement between a real estate broker and a seller to officially terminate their listing agreement without any pending bids. Key features include the effective date of termination, a waiver by the broker of any claims against the seller, and a release of obligations for future services by the broker. Specific financial arrangements regarding prior expenses are noted, requiring reimbursement for advertising and marketing costs. This form serves as a valuable resource for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ants involved in real estate transactions, providing clarity in the termination process and protecting the rights of both parties. Filling out the form requires the date of termination and financial details, ensuring both broker and seller are in agreement. It is essential for maintaining clear communication and formalizing the end of a listing without complications.

To end a listing early: In Seller Hub: Go to the Manage active listings page. Select the checkbox next to the item(s) you want to end. From the dropdown menu, select End listing. In My eBay: Go to Active in the Selling section. Find the item, and from the dropdown menu, select End listing. Or use the quick link.

You can only end auction listings with bids one at a time by selecting a valid reason. Ending listings early disappoints bidders, so we may place limits and restrictions on your account if you are doing so regularly.

Yes - as long as no bids. Just use the drop down menu against the item and select "End Listings".
